Output 4390831a73b46beab954cbc3255dfae75d13d4516f75437fc44f36119d61051a:0

value
2885114661
script pubkey
OP_0 OP_PUSHBYTES_20 ab3ec9dc6b9848dba49d8b69140fd4305f4af438
address
ltc1q4vlvnhrtnpydhfya3d53gr75xp054apcfeykyj
transaction
4390831a73b46beab954cbc3255dfae75d13d4516f75437fc44f36119d61051a
spent
true